What is Acpe IV certification?

IV Certification. NPTA’s Sterile Product (IV) Certification Course has been designed to train pharmacy technicians and pharmacists on the topic of sterile product preparation and aseptic technique, including USP <797>. The course is ACPE accredited.Click to see full answer. Intravenous (IV) Certification: $600 – $800.What does ACPE accreditation mean?ACPE accreditation is public recognition that a professional degree program leading to the Doctor of Pharmacy degree is judged to meet established qualifications and education standards through initial and subsequent periodic evaluations. Accreditation is distinguished from licensure, which applies to individuals.
